Abstract

We shall recall a few notions and results that crop up frequently concerning the diffusion equation

$${u_t} - D\Delta u = f$$

defined on a cylindrical domain Q T = Ω × (0, T), where Ω is a domain (connected, open subset) of ℝn. Here u = u(x, t), and the Laplacian Δ is taken with respect to the spatial variables x only.
